When queer folk want kids, we really have to plan. For us, there’s usually no straightforward “old-fashioned way.”
But as one couple learns, plans alone are sometimes not enough. Harriet and Meegan, a lesbian couple, have been trying for a baby for a long time. This is the story of how Plan A, became Plan B, became Plan C.
